Nick Pappas, CSFM, currently serves as Field Director for the National Football League (NFL) since February 2020, overseeing field operations for high-profile events including the Super Bowl and International series games, while collaborating with Player Health & Safety on playing surface initiatives. Pappas has held various roles at AMB Sports and Entertainment since September 2018, including Head Groundskeeper for International Series Games and Pitch Advisor for the upcoming 2026 FIFA World Cup. Previous experience includes serving as Assistant Director of Stadium Operations and Head Groundskeeper at the same organization, as well as positions at GreenSource Sports Turf & Landscape, Miami Marlins, Florida Panthers, and Miami Dolphins. Pappas holds a Bachelor of Science in Plant, Soil & Insect Sciences and an Associate's Degree in Turfgrass Management from the University of Massachusetts Amherst.
